Reeder Canyon Trail Project
    The Reeder Canyon Trail Project was completed June 24-26. Many volunteers tuned out to help and were greatly appreciated. A temporary bridge was built at the bottom of the canyon to cross Reeder Creek. A portion of the big rock was shaved off to make the trail safer. Several new bridges were also installed in the canyon to eliminate damage to wet areas of the trail. Both the north and south trails were cleared of downed trees and the loop is travelable now.
